4. What are the responsibilities of Civil Engineering Technologist III?
Responsible for applying engineering principles in the implementation of products, systems, and processes. Works with civil engineers in the planning, designing, and building of infrastructure and development projects. Helps engineers in the planning of construction projects such as airports, bridges, channels, dams, railroads, and roads. Estimates workload to establish project deadlines and helps prepare proposals and cost estimates. Responsible for recommending maintenance, repair, and preparing reports for review by an engineer. Requires a bachelor's degree in engineering or related degree. Typically reports to a manager. Work is generally independent and collaborative in nature. Contributes to moderately complex aspects of a project. Typically requires 4-7 years of related experience.
